/*
Engenetics print style sheet
*/

body {margin:0 auto; padding:0; font-family:"Times New Roman",Serif; background:#ffffff; color:#000000; font-size: 12pt;}
#printheadercontainer, #printlogo, #printfooter {display: block;  clear:both; }
.printhide { display:inline; }
#container, .story, #printheadercontainer, #printlogo, #printfooter, #footercopyright {margin:2%; width:auto; float:none !important;}
#main {float:none !important;}
#logo h1 {margin:0 0 10px 0;}
#toptabs, #navitabs, #sidebar, .hide, #nextprevious, #mainmenutabs, #pagenavigationtabs, #footerlogos, #bottomnextprevious, .excerptsheader, .wp_excerpts, .wp_comments, .col3 {display:none;}
#footer #footercopyright, .copyright { display: block; clear:both;}
.rights { display: inline; }
a {text-decoration:underline; color:#0000FF;}
.imageright {float:right;}
.imageleft {float:left; }
.picture { border: 1px solid #CCCCCC; padding: 3px; 
font-family: Arial, sans-serif; text-align:center; page-break-inside:avoid; 
     page-break-after:avoid; font-size: 12pt; line-height: 14pt; } 
.picture img { border: 1px solid #CCCCCC; 
vertical-align:middle; margin-bottom: 3px; page-break-inside:avoid; 
     page-break-after:avoid; } 
.rightimage { margin: 0.5em 0pt 0.5em 0.8em; float:right; page-break-inside:avoid; 
     page-break-after:avoid; } 
.leftimage { margin: 0.5em 0.8em 0.5em 0; float:left; page-break-inside:avoid; 
     page-break-after:avoid; }
.body-text-continue, .body-text, .quotes, .listing, .list1, .quotes-first-line-indent, .quotes-within-quotes, .table-data, .quotes-first-line-indent, .quotations-group-quotes, .quotations-group-quotes-first-line-indent, .quotations-group-quotes-within-quotes, .listings-listing-numerical-restart, .listing-lower-alpha, .listing-upper-alpha, ul, li, .listing-lower-alpha, .listing-lower-alpha-restart, .quotes-listings-roman, .stressenergytensortable {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-size: 12pt;
	line-height: 14pt;
}
.body-text-continue, .body-text {
	margin-top: 6pt;
	margin-bottom: 6pt;
}

#logo h1, #logo p, #footercopyright p, .rights, .copyright {text-align: center; font-size: 8pt; margin: 0;}
.italic {
	font-style: italic;
}
.bold {
	font-weight: bold;
}
.subscript {
	vertical-align: baseline;
	font-size: 8pt;
	line-height: 0;
	position: relative;
	top: 2pt;
}

.superscript {
	vertical-align: baseline;
	position: relative;
	font-size: 8pt;
	line-height: 0;
	top: -2pt;
}

.largesigma {
	font-size: 160%;
}
.largesigmasubscript {
	vertical-align: sub;
}

.largeintegralsign {
	font-size: 190%;
}
.largeintegralsubscript {
	vertical-align: sub;
	font-size: 60%;
	margin-left: -3px;
}

ol.listing, ol.list1, .listings-listing-numerical-restart, .listing-lower-alpha, .listing-upper-alpha, ul, li, .listing-lower-alpha, .listing-lower-alpha-restart {margin:0 30pt 0 24pt; padding:0;}

ol.listing li, ol.listing-numerical, ol.listings-listing-numerical-restart li, ol.listing-lower-alpha li, ol.listing-upper-alpha li, ul li, .listing-lower-alpha li, .listing-lower-alpha-restart li{margin:0 0 0 0;}

.listing-lower-alpha, .listing-lower-alpha-restart, .listings-listing-lower-alpha-restart, .listings-listing-lower-alpha {
	list-style-type: lower-alpha;	
}
.listing-upper-alpha, .listing-upper-alpha-restart {
	list-style-type: upper-alpha;	
}
.listing-bulleted {
	list-style-type: disc;
}

.listings-listing-upper-roman-restart {
	list-style-type: upper-roman;
}


.quotes, .quotes-first-line-indent, .quotes-within-quotes, .quotations-group-quotes-first-line-indent, .quotations-group-quotes-within-quotes, .quotations-group-quotes, .quotes-listings-numbers, .quotes-listings-numbers-restart, .quotes-listings-roman  {
	margin-right: 1pt;
	margin-left: 60pt;
	font-size: 11pt;
}
.quotes, .quotations-group-quotes-within-quotes {
	margin-top: 4pt;
	margin-bottom: 4pt;
}

.quotes-first-line-indent, .quotations-group-quotes-first-line-indent, .quotes-listings-numbers, .quotes-listings-numbers-restart, .quotes-listings-numbers-restart-bold, .quotes-listings-numbers-bold, .quotes-listings-bullets, .quotes-listings-roman {
	text-indent:12pt;
}
 
ol.quotes-listings-numbers, ol.quotes-listings-numbers-restart, ol.quotes-listings-numbers-restart-bold, ol.quotes-listings-numbers-bold, .quotes-listings-roman  {
	margin-left: 12pt;
	padding-left: 24pt;
}

.quotes-listings-roman {
	list-style-type: upper-roman;	
}


.quotes-listings-numbers-restart-bold, .quotes-listings-numbers-bold {
	font-weight: bold;
}

.citations {
	text-decoration: underline;
}

.section-headers {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 14pt;
}
.sub-section-headers {
	margin-left: 18pt;
	list-style-type: none;
	margin-top: 18pt;
	margin-bottom: 0;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 12pt;

}

.quotes .subscript, .quotations-group-quotes .subscript {
	font-size: 8pt;
}
table  {
 width: 95%;
 border: 1pt solid #240403;
}

table th, table td  {
	text-align: left;
	border: thin solid #240403;
	padding-left: 1pt;
	padding-right: 2pt;
}
table th {
	font-weight: bold;
}

.stressenergytensortable, .stressenergytensortable table, .stressenergytensortable table td, .stressenergytensortable table th {
	border: 0;
}

.gaussianinteger {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}
.maxims-of-ecology-header {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 13pt;
	text-align:center;
	margin-top: 14pt;
}

.mathematical-laws-final-declaration {
	text-align:center;
	font-size: 14pt;
	margin-top: 14pt;
}
.maxims-of-ecology {
	font-size: 14pt;
	margin-top: 14pt;
	margin-left: 14pt;
	margin-right: 14pt;
}
.mathematical-laws {
	text-align: center;
	font-size: 12pt;
	list-style-type: none;
}

.mysmallcaps, .smallcaps {
	font-variant:small-caps;
}
.hamiltonian {
	font-family: Arial, Helvetica, sans-serif;
	font-style: italic;
	font-weight: bold;
}
.onelineequation {
	text-align: center;
}

